Список категорий пользовательских типов сообщений без дочерних категорий - PullRequest
0 голосов
/ 19 сентября 2019

Я создал post_type = ug-dept и taxonomy = dept.Под кафедрой таксономии созданы некоторые категории и подкатегории.Добавлен пост в это.

Теперь в списке Подкатегория также в списке.

      <ul>
        <?php wp_list_categories('taxonomy=dept&orderby=id&title_li=&include_children=false');?>
      </ul>
      

      Как удалить дочерний элемент в списке категорий.Пожалуйста, не давайте решение, подобное: 'exclude' => '12, 13 'К этому каждый раз, когда мне нужно добавить.

      Почему «include_children = false» не работает?

      1 Ответ

      1 голос
      / 19 сентября 2019
      $cat_args = array(
          'taxonomy' => 'dept',
          'orderby' => 'id',
          'order' => 'ASC',
          'parent' => 0,
      );
      $cat_data = get_categories( $cat_args ); 
      
      foreach ( $cat_data as $cat ) {
            echo $cat->name;
      }
      

      Это вам поможет

      ...